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/ˌhuli ka balˈbon/, [ˌhu.lɪ xɐ bɐlˈbon]
  • Hyphenation: hu‧li ka bal‧bon

Interjection[edit]

huli ka, balbón! (Baybayin spelling ᜑᜓᜎᜒ ᜃ ᜊᜎ᜔ᜊᜓᜈ᜔)

  1. (slang) Synonym of huli ka: gotcha! got you! (as in capture or in the act)
